mysql数据库中 如何设置一个时间段 字段?
比如2012-12-2609:00-11:00这种形式这种形式,设置的数据类型是什么,还是直接varchar???...
比如
2012-12-26 09:00 - 11:00 这种形式
这种形式,设置的数据类型是什么 ,还是直接 varchar??? 展开
2012-12-26 09:00 - 11:00 这种形式
这种形式,设置的数据类型是什么 ,还是直接 varchar??? 展开
3个回答
展开全部
可以放两个字段来存储
startTime (2012-12-26 09:00), EndTime (2012-12-26 11:00)
startTime (2012-12-26 09:00), EndTime (2012-12-26 11:00)
更多追问追答
追问
数据类型是什么
追答
DateTime类型
本回答被提问者采纳
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
这个随便了,你想怎么放就怎么放,放时间戳吧!整型的,取出来后用php的date()格式化,爽得很。
追问
要不您敲几行,我是菜鸟
追答
取时间戳,有个mktime函数能够产生指定时间的时间戳,time函数产生当前的时间戳,date格式化时间戳。自己看手册去。
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
你说的这只能设置为varchar这种数据类型。
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询